What are the responsibilities and job description for the Sr. Java Software Engineer Hybrid GC/USC only position at Excellent Pro Group Inc?
REQUIRED SKILLS
5 Years Experience
Developing internet-scale solution development primarily using Java, Spring Boot and no-sql databases
- Must have demonstrated proficiency and experience in the following tools and technologies:
- Java 11 (Lambdas, Streams, Completable Future, optional, generics)
- Java functional and reactive programming
- Test Driven Development
- Asynchronous Reactive Micro services utilizing Vert.x
- REST APIs using Spring Boot 2.0 (reactive) and skilled in Open API (swagger) specification
- Designing database schemas, index design, optimizations for query tuning
- Experience with workflow orchestrators, preferably Temporal
- Good knowledge of messaging systems like Kafka, MQ
Preferred Qualifications
- Previous experience with payment systems or real-time transaction platforms.
- Experience in API development for fintech applications.
Kindly share your updated resume at sam.shaw@excellentprogroup.com. Feel free to reach out to the same email for any further inquiries.